CEMB CM27T: the chuck that lifts the wheel for you

The single most important thing about the CM27T is not on the front of the machine. It is the pivoting four-jaw clamping chuck, which does two jobs instead of one: it clamps the wheel, and it acts as the wheel lift. On a machine built for over-the-road Class 8 truck and bus assemblies — and some off-road tractor tires and rims — that is not a convenience feature. It is the difference between a job two technicians wrestle with and a job one technician runs, and it is the reason commercial tire work injures fewer backs than it used to.

Around that chuck is a heavy-duty universal changer that handles tube and tubeless tires, self-centres on the rim, and is driven entirely from a portable control unit rather than from a fixed console. That last point is worth as much as the first, and we will come back to it.

Self-centring clamping, and the range that actually matters

The clamping range is 13"–27" rim diameter, with tire diameters accepted up to 63". The number that matters day to day, though, is the nominal heavy-duty truck service band of 15"–24.5" rims — that is where the bulk of commercial work sits, and it sits comfortably inside the machine's range rather than at the edge of it. A changer working in the middle of its capability is a changer that stays accurate and stays in one piece; one permanently at its limits is not.

Self-centring is doing real work here too. A truck wheel that is not concentric on the chuck fights every subsequent operation, and on assemblies this heavy that shows up as scored rim flanges and damaged beads. The four jaws pivot to take the rim and pull it true before anything else happens.

The portable control unit

Everything is operated from a control unit the technician carries. That sounds minor until you have tried to lubricate a bead, watch a mount head and reach a fixed panel at the same time. With the controls in hand the operator stands where the work is, and bead lubrication, demounting and mounting are all watched while they happen rather than driven blind from six feet away.

Two forces, doing two different jobs

The specification quotes two forces and they are frequently confused, so it is worth separating them properly. The bead loosening roller is adjustable and exerts over 4,100 lbs of force; it works progressively around the bead seat, in combination with bi-directional rotation of the clamping system, to break a bead free without hammering it. The bead breaker force is 3,300 lbs (1,500 kg) and is the machine's dedicated bead-breaking action. They are separate mechanisms with separate numbers, and a stubborn commercial tire usually meets both.

Bi-directional rotation deserves a line of its own. Being able to reverse the table means a bead that has hung up can be backed off and taken again from the other direction, instead of being forced. On an expensive aluminium truck rim, backing off is a much better instinct than pushing harder.

Power, hydraulics and air

Drive is a heavy-duty high-torque motor running on 220 V, 1 ph, 50/60 Hz. The machine's maximum operating pressure of 1,885 PSI (130 bar) is the hydraulic working pressure of the system itself — it is not a shop air requirement, and it is not something you supply. It is quoted because it tells you what the machine is built to withstand internally, which on equipment that spends its life breaking commercial beads is a fair proxy for how long it will last.

Will it fit your shop?

Two practical constraints. First, electrical: you need a 220 V single-phase supply at 50/60 Hz within reach of the machine's final position. Providing that circuit and having it connected by a licensed electrician to local code is the customer's responsibility, and it is worth confirming before the machine arrives rather than after.

Second, space and access. The crate is L63" x W59" x H41" with a gross shipping weight of 1,415 lbs (640 kg). Measure the route in as well as the floor space — the doorway, the threshold, and any turn tight enough to matter — because a machine that fits the bay but not the corridor is a bad afternoon. Once it is in position, leave working room around the whole assembly: on truck wheels the technician needs to walk the tire, which is the entire point of the portable control unit.

A published figure that is labelled two ways

The 63" (1,600 mm) capacity appears in the specification table as "maximum wheel diameter" and everywhere else in the manufacturer's material as the maximum tire diameter. On a commercial assembly those are not the same measurement, and the difference is large. We read it as the overall tire-and-wheel assembly diameter, which is how the rest of the data uses it, but we have printed the discrepancy rather than hiding it. If you are buying this machine specifically for assemblies near that limit, contact us and we will confirm the correct reading with the manufacturer before you order.
